EXECUTIVE SUMMARY
Positioned at a high-traffic, signalized intersection in Mill Spring, North Carolina, this 5.33-acre investment property offers a rare combination of income stability and future development potential. The site features a seven-unit commercial strip center, a freestanding 1,800 SF corner building currently home to a coffee and ice cream shop, and two leased residential units. All spaces are fully occupied, with commercial leases currently below market rates, presenting upside for repositioning.
The property benefits from three road frontages—655 feet on SR 1368, 500 feet on Hwy 9, and 860 feet on Hwy 108—ensuring maximum visibility and accessibility. Located near Lake Lure, Lake Adger, Tryon Equestrian Center, and I-26, the site serves as a regional crossroads with direct access to Columbus, Rutherfordton, and Spartanburg, SC. The area’s demographic profile includes a median household income of $69.6K and a growing population, supporting long-term commercial viability.
Infrastructure includes city water, six septic systems, and additional approved septic capacity for RV pads or tiny homes. A newly installed 52 KW Generac generator adds operational resilience and income potential. The unzoned status and unrestricted land use allow for flexible redevelopment or expansion, making this an ideal acquisition for owner-users or investors seeking a foothold in Polk County’s limited commercial inventory.
